Frequently asked questions
Why is 1 not prime?
Primes have exactly two distinct divisors. 1 has only one, and treating it as prime would break unique factorisation.
What is the largest known prime?
As of 2024 it is 2^136,279,841 − 1, a Mersenne prime with over 41 million digits.
